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
Answer:

Banda - It is part of the western South Pacific and surrounded by the south Molucca Islands. It covers an area of 470,000 kmē.
Arafura - This shallow sea lies between Indonesia and Australia and lies in the western Pacific Ocean. It covers an area of 650,000 kmē.
Celebes - Also known as Sulawesi Sea, it is part of the western Pacific, with an area of 280,000 kmē.
Bismarck - It is part of the southwestern Pacific within Papua New Guinea and it covers an area of 40,000 kmē.
Sulu - It lies in the southwestern area of the Philippines and covers an area of 260,000 kmē.
Bohai - This sea lies in the northern part of the Yellow Sea and covers an area of 78,000 kmē.
Coral - It lies in the south Pacific in the northeastern part of Australia and covers the Great Barrier Reef. It occupies an area of 4.791 million kmē.
Seram - Also known as Ceram, it lies between a number of Indonesian islands. It covers an area of 120,000 kmē.
Salish - It is located in the Canadian province of British Columbia and covers an area of 110,000 km2.
Koro - This is a sea in the nation of Fiji and covers an area of 58,000 kmē.
Bering - It lies in northern Pacific along the Bering Strait and covers an area of 2 million kmē.
Tasman - This sea lies in the south Pacific, between Australia and New Zealand, covering an area of 2.3 million kmē.
Okhotsk - It lies in the western Pacific near the Kamchatka Peninsula, taking up an area of 1.583 million kmē.
Mar de Grau - It lies near the coast of Peru and covers an area of 1.141 million kmē.
Molucca - This sea lies in the western Pacific near the Indonesian Islands of Celebes and covers an area of 58,000 kmē.
The trouble makers:
Wadden lies in the North Sea, Bothnian in the Baltic, Wandel, Kara, Beaufort, Chukchi, Latev in the Arctic, White in the Barents Sea, Red in the Indian Ocean and Black is an extension of the Mediterranean between Europe and Asia.
